Abstract

Organ cultured rat diaphragm segments were used to assay a factor which increases endplate-specific acetylcholinesterase. This factor can be substantially purified by vacuum distilling it at 37°C into a dry-ice-acetone cold trap. Sources from which the factor can be distilled include eel electric organ homogenate, rat diaphragm homogenate, and medium conditioned with neurally stimulated muscle.
